Clore Institute
for High-Field Magnetic Resonance Imaging and Spectroscopy

The Clore Institute for High-Field Magnetic Resonance Imaging and Spectroscopy supports research questions spanning across all realms of science – from physiology and biochemistry in cells, tissues, animals, and humans; to the structure and dynamics of chemicals and biomolecules; to studies of advanced and new materials. The Institute also develops methods for high-field mag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) and data processing, as well as technologies for exploring related phenomena.
